Consider the following
1. `4hat(i) xx 3hat(i) = 0` II. `(4hat(i))/(3hat(i))= (4)/(3)`
Which of the above statements is/are correct?

A

Only I

B

Only II

C

Both I and II

D

Neither I nor II

The correct Answer is:
To determine which of the statements is correct, we will analyze each statement step by step. **Step 1: Analyze Statement I** - The first statement is: \( 4\hat{i} \times 3\hat{i} = 0 \). - Here, we are performing the cross product of two vectors \( 4\hat{i} \) and \( 3\hat{i} \). - Recall that the cross product of any vector with itself is zero. Therefore, \( \hat{i} \times \hat{i} = 0 \). - Thus, \( 4\hat{i} \times 3\hat{i} = 12(\hat{i} \times \hat{i}) = 12 \cdot 0 = 0 \). - Therefore, Statement I is **correct**. **Step 2: Analyze Statement II** - The second statement is: \( \frac{4\hat{i}}{3\hat{i}} = \frac{4}{3} \). - Here, we are trying to simplify the expression \( \frac{4\hat{i}}{3\hat{i}} \). - However, when dividing vectors, we cannot simply cancel out the unit vectors like scalars. The operation is not valid in vector algebra. - Therefore, \( \frac{4\hat{i}}{3\hat{i}} \) does not equal \( \frac{4}{3} \) because this operation is meaningless. - Thus, Statement II is **incorrect**. **Final Conclusion** - From our analysis, we find that: - Statement I is correct. - Statement II is incorrect. - Therefore, the correct answer is that **only Statement I is correct**.
